Should You Buy a 1989 Suzuki GSX-R1100?
The 1989 Suzuki GSX-R1100 is a legendary sportbike that combines impressive performance with a lightweight design. With a powerful 1.1L engine producing 136 horsepower and 59 lb-ft of torque, this motorcycle is designed for speed enthusiasts who appreciate raw power and agility. While specific details on fuel economy and MSRP are not available, the GSX-R1100 is known for its exhilarating ride and track-ready capabilities, making it a sought-after model among collectors and riders alike. Its aerodynamic styling and advanced engineering for its time contribute to its status as a classic in the sportbike category.
Potential buyers should be aware that while the GSX-R1100 is celebrated for its performance, it may not be the most comfortable option for long rides due to its sport-focused ergonomics. Riders looking for a bike that excels in handling and acceleration will find the GSX-R1100 to be a thrilling choice, but those seeking a more versatile motorcycle for daily commuting may want to consider alternatives.
The ideal buyer for the 1989 Suzuki GSX-R1100 is a passionate sportbike enthusiast or collector who values performance and historical significance over everyday practicality.

Known Issues (NHTSA Data)
No significant NHTSA complaints on record. However, as with many older sportbikes, potential buyers should inspect for common wear and tear issues such as suspension wear, brake performance, and electrical system reliability. Regular maintenance history can also provide insight into the bike's condition.
